Daily Inspiration Quote by Lou Ferrigno

"I know right a way there's a person that's very insecure; that he's trying to out do me. And, ah, like I was saying before, if you give one-hundred percent of your best, and you may have fault, but there is nothing you can do, because you gave one-hundred percent"

About this Quote

Ferrigno is talking like a man who’s spent his life being stared at, measured, and challenged - and learned to treat that pressure as background noise. The first move is blunt social radar: “I know right a way” signals instant detection, a sixth sense for insecurity in others. He’s not describing a rival so much as diagnosing a type: the person who “tries to out do me” not from ambition, but from a need to self-medicate doubt. The subtext is quietly compassionate and quietly unimpressed.

Then he pivots to a philosophy that feels born from bodybuilding and celebrity at once: you can’t control the scoreboard, only the effort. The repeated “one-hundred percent” is less motivational-poster fluff than a defense mechanism against a culture that never stops grading you. Ferrigno’s career - as the Hulk, as a physique icon, as a performer often reduced to “the big guy” - is basically a case study in being judged for outcomes you can’t fully direct: casting, editing, typecasting, even genetics. “You may have fault” acknowledges imperfection without letting it become a trapdoor into shame.

What makes the quote work is its refusal to romanticize competition. He reframes rivalry as someone else’s insecurity project, not his mission. The message isn’t “win”; it’s “don’t let other people’s inner chaos set your pace.” In a world obsessed with comparison, Ferrigno offers a tougher, calmer standard: effort as closure. If you gave everything, the critic in your head - and the insecure person beside you - loses the last word.
